Frequently Asked Questions about South Salt Lake

How much are Studio apartments in South Salt Lake?

There are currently 339 Studio Apartments in South Salt Lake with rent ranges from $750 to $3,489 with an average price of $1,395.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om South Salt Lake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in South Salt Lake ranges from $639 to $4,294 with an average monthly rent of $1,523.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in South Salt Lake c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in South Salt Lake range from $766 to $20,584.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,856.

How expensive are South Salt Lake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 113 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in South Salt Lake on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$897 to $4,590 - averaging $2,049 for the location.
